public class AutoResetUniTaskCompletionSource : IUniTaskSource, ITaskPoolNode<AutoResetUniTaskCompletionSource>, IPromise, IResolvePromise, IRejectPromise, ICancelPromise
InheritanceSystem.Object → AutoResetUniTaskCompletionSource
Members Properties Methods Properties NextNode
public ref AutoResetUniTaskCompletionSource NextNode { get; }
Property Value
public UniTask Task { get; }
Property Value
public static AutoResetUniTaskCompletionSource Create()
Returns
public static AutoResetUniTaskCompletionSource CreateCompleted(out short token)
Parameters
token
System.Int16
public static AutoResetUniTaskCompletionSource CreateFromCanceled(CancellationToken cancellationToken, out short token)
Parameters
cancellationToken
CancellationToken
token
System.Int16
public static AutoResetUniTaskCompletionSource CreateFromException(Exception exception, out short token)
Parameters
exception
System.Exception
token
System.Int16
public void GetResult(short token)
Parameters
token
System.Int16
public UniTaskStatus GetStatus(short token)
Parameters
token
System.Int16
public void OnCompleted(Action<object> continuation, object state, short token)
Parameters
continuation
System.Action<System.Object>
state
System.Object
token
System.Int16
public bool TrySetCanceled(CancellationToken cancellationToken = null)
Parameters
cancellationToken
CancellationToken
public bool TrySetException(Exception exception)
Parameters
exception
System.Exception
public bool TrySetResult()
Returns
public UniTaskStatus UnsafeGetStatus()
Returns
RetroSearch is an open source project built by @garambo | Open a GitHub Issue
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o
HTML:
3.2
| Encoding:
UTF-8
| Version:
0.7.4